On June 14th, 2026, an intelligence-led operation in the Northern Division resulted in the arrest of a 33-year-old St. Augustine man and the seizure of substantial quantities of cannabis and ammunition. The operation, conducted between 10am and 5pm, led officers to the suspect’s home where they discovered 2.75 kilogrammes of cannabis hidden in a mini-mart on his property.
In tandem, officers conducted a second operation in the Cunipia district, unearthing 30 rounds of 5.56 ammunition concealed in a chicken coup on Cemetery Street.
These operations were overseen by senior officials, including Snr. Supt. Bhagwandeen and Supt. Glodon, with the support of the Central Operations Unit, the Central Division Task Force, Area North, the Canine Branch and the Special Investigations Unit.
Meanwhile, in the Eastern Division, a separate incident resulted in the arrest of a Valencia man. Following a report of Wounding with Intent, the individual was taken into custody after allegedly attacking another man with two cutlasses, causing several injuries.
As of now, investigations continue into both matters, as law enforcement works tirelessly to maintain public safety and order.
